The King expresses condolences to Angola on former President Dos Santos death

His Majesty the King has sent a telegram to the President of Angola, João Lourenço, in which he expresses his condolences to the Angolan Government and people on the death of the country’s former president from 1979 to 2017, José Eduardo dos Santos.

 

In his message, Don Felipe expresses his condolences on behalf of himself, the Government of Spain and the people of Spain on the death of the former president, of whom he highlights that, in very difficult times, he worked firmly to achieve peace and promote reconciliation and the reconstruction of the Angolan nation.

 

José Eduardo dos Santos died last Friday in a clinic in Barcelona, where he had been hospitalised since the end of June.
